QUESTION 3
Step1: Consider distance formula
The distance formula between two points \((x_1,y_1)\) and \((x_2,y_2)\) in the coordinate plane is \(d = \sqrt{(x_2 - x_1)^2+(y_2 - y_1)^2}\). If we consider the right - triangle formed by the two points and the horizontal and vertical displacements between them, the distance between the two points is the length of the hypotenuse of this right - triangle.
